About Rizwan Ullah

Rizwan Ullah is a scholar working on Pollution, Water Science and Technology, Health, Toxicology and Mutagenesis, Radiological and Ultrasound Technology and Artificial Intelligence, having authored 27 papers that have together received 335 indexed citations. Recurring topics across this work include Heavy metals in environment (8 papers), Radioactivity and Radon Measurements (5 papers), Water Quality and Pollution Assessment (4 papers), Mercury impact and mitigation studies (4 papers), Geochemistry and Geologic Mapping (4 papers), Heavy Metal Exposure and Toxicity (4 papers), Groundwater and Watershed Analysis (3 papers) and Groundwater and Isotope Geochemistry (3 papers). The work is most often cited by research in Pollution (167 citations), Radiological and Ultrasound Technology (72 citations), Health, Toxicology and Mutagenesis (107 citations), Water Science and Technology (104 citations) and Geochemistry and Petrology (28 citations). Rizwan Ullah has collaborated with scholars based in Pakistan, Saudi Arabia and Germany. Frequent co-authors include Said Muhammad, Syed Ali Musstjab Akber Shah Eqani, Heqing Shen, Ambreen Alamdar, Avit Kumar Bhowmik, Nadeem Ali, Syeda Maria Ali, Mauro Fasola, Ashfaq Ahmad and Abeer A. AlObaid. Their work appears in journals such as International Journal of Environmental & Analytical Chemistry, Environmental Geochemistry and Health, International Journal of Chemical Kinetics, Environmental Monitoring and Assessment and Arabian Journal for Science and Engineering.
